You can never have too many side dish recipes, so give Mushroom-Wild Rice Pilaf a try. One serving contains 233 calories, 6g of protein, and 12g of fat. This recipe covers 10% of your daily requirements of vitamins and minerals. This recipe serves 6. If you have beef-flavored broth, salt, coarse ground pepper, and a few other ingredients on hand, you can make it.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es approximately 1 hour. It is a good option if you're following a gluten free diet.

Instructions

1
In 3-quart saucepan, melt 1/4 cup of the butter over medium-high heat. Cook onion in butter 3 minutes.

Add mushrooms; cook 3 minutes longer, stirring occasionally, until onion is tender and mushrooms are golden.

Add wild rice and brown rice; cook and stir 1 minute.

Stir in broth.

Heat to boiling; reduce heat. Cover; simmer 45 to 50 minutes or until rice is tender and liquid is absorbed. Stir in remaining 2 tablespoons butter, the thyme, salt and pepper.
